My God Has A Telephone
Candi Staton's song uses the metaphor of a telephone to describe prayer, emphasizing that God is always available to hear and answer. The lyrics speak of reaching out to God in times of burden and uncertainty, and finding strength and clarity through that connection. The song encourages persistence in prayer and reassures that God's voice is clear and powerful, even for those who feel spiritually deaf. It highlights the idea of putting faith over fear and trusting that God will respond, regardless of the season or circumstance.
